Across CCLE and GDSC cell-line panels, response to KIN001-266 is significantly associated with the total protein of multiple proteins, with BLOOD_Lymphoma cell lines showing a particularly strong set of associations.
The most reproducible KIN001-266 response-associated proteins across cancer lineages are p62 Lck ligand, 14-3-3_epsilon, and Annexin_VII, each associated with drug response in up to 7 lineages. Since the analysis identifies associations rather than directional relationships, both response-to-biomarker and biomarker-to-response views are provided.
Each biomarker is linked to its corresponding Q-omics profile. The scatter plot shows the strongest observed association, KIN001-266 response versus p62 Lck ligand total protein in BLOOD_Lymphoma (Pearson r = -0.50).
